Transaction 0193b184710507d529f366ce6bd0cc74e01009a996fd6fa82c2072ece4623fb9

2 Input
1 Outputs
  • 0193b184710507d529f366ce6bd0cc74e01009a996fd6fa82c2072ece4623fb9:0
  • value  97955716
    address  3JcsCDePGX85cLS9vAYTCCn9ZLPpQZueWu